Leonel Lopez Saenz Mata Ortiz Olla – Sgraffito Lizard Design, 5.5" x 8"
This beautifully hand-coiled olla is by renowned Mata Ortiz ceramicist Leonel Lopez Saenz, celebrated for his dynamic sgraffito carving and imaginative animal motifs. Originating from the artisan-rich village of Mata Ortiz in Chihuahua, Mexico, Lopez Saenz brings ancient Paquimé pottery techniques into a modern narrative through his refined craftsmanship.
The wide-bodied, low-profile form features a rich interplay of red and white geometric linework, meticulously etched to create hypnotic visual symmetry. Surrounding the body are multiple stylized black lizards—each one unique—carved within textured medallions. The underside of one lizard bears the incised signature “Leonel Lopez Saenz,” affirming its authenticity.
Leonel Lopez Saenz, active since the early 1990s, is part of the second wave of Mata Ortiz artisans. His works are recognized for their blend of ancestral symbolism and contemporary artistry, making this olla a compelling addition to folk art and Southwestern collections.
